Fig. 1: Assessment of the multilineage differentiation potential of miR-150-transfected ASCs.

a Comparison of gross cell morphology of ASCs with/without miR-150 transfection. There was no difference in gross cell morphology between the two groups. b Flow cytometric analysis of ASCs transfected with miR-150. The miR-150-transfected ASCs were negative for CD31 and CD45 (hematopoietic stem cell markers) and positive for CD73 and CD105 (mesenchymal stem cell markers), and the expression pattern in ASCs without miR-150 transfection was identical to that of transfected ASCs. c Successful adipogenic [Top] and osteogenic [Bottom] differentiation of miR-150-transfected ASCs. Adipogenic and osteogenic differentiation were identified using Oil Red O and Alizarin red stains, respectively. d Successful chondrogenic differentiation of miR-150-transfected ASCs. Chondrogenic differentiation was identified using collagen types 1 and 2 and proteoglycan stains. Scale bars = 100 µm. The values are presented as the mean ± standard deviation of three independent experiments. *P < 0.05. ASC adipose-derived stem cell, t-ASC miR-150-transfected adipose tissue-derived stem cell.
